Tuki appeals disgruntled MLAs to return

From our correspondent
Itagar, Nov 26: Aruchal Pradesh Chief Minister bam Tuki has appealed to those party legislators, who are camping in New Delhi, to return to the state and devote their time and energy in developmental works. “On this joyous occasion of Chalo Loku, we are missing some of our friends, whose presence would have added more colours to the celebration. I appeal to my friends to come back to the state and their home constituencies and start developmental works. What we have promised to our people during elections need to be delivered,” Tuki said while addressing the people at Chalo-Loku celebration here on Wednesday. “The state has limited working season and all should make good use of these seasons to deliver their best to the common people,” Tuki said. At the same time, Tuki made it clear that the wagon of development would not stop due to absence of few of the lawmaker friends.
